Trump’s Cabinet Meeting Signals a New Tech Era

A recent cabinet meeting shifted from routine updates to a discussion on America’s role in artificial intelligence. What began as a standard review of trade, infrastructure, and economic matters quickly took a different turn when former President Donald Trump introduced a new topic. During the meeting, Trump presented materials outlining plans for one of the largest proposed AI facilities in the United States.

The project, shared with him by Meta CEO Mark Zuckerberg, would be located in Louisiana and cover more than 2,000 acres. According to the presentation, the site would feature nine buildings designed to support advanced computing systems. Trump emphasized the size of the investment, noting estimates in the billions of dollars.

While reports varied on the total cost, the scale of the project was clear. To meet the high energy requirements, three natural gas plants were reportedly approved to help power the facility. Members of the cabinet discussed the broader significance of such infrastructure. Interior Secretary Doug Burgum highlighted the connection between energy and technological capacity, pointing out that reliable power supplies are essential for competing in the global AI landscape.

The discussion also touched on the United States’ position in relation to other countries, particularly China. Officials expressed both optimism about America’s innovation and concern over international competition. In addition to technology, the meeting covered trade and manufacturing, with Trump noting increased construction activity tied to new tariff policies. While several topics were raised, the AI project stood out as a symbol of private sector investment and the country’s commitment to advancing its digital future. The meeting underscored how emerging technologies, energy infrastructure, and global competition are shaping long-term economic strategy in the United States.
